Course Details

Glass Science and Technology: Fundamentals of glass chemistry, properties of glass materials, and advanced glass technologies.
Glass Melting and Forming: Processes and techniques for melting and forming glass, including furnace design and operation.
Engineering Properties of Glass: Mechanical, thermal, and optical properties of glass, and their impact on design and performance.
Glass Packaging Design: Principles of package design, with a focus on glass, including material selection, container geometry, and closure systems.
Quality Control and Assurance in Glass Packaging: Methods and techniques for ensuring quality in glass packaging, including statistical process control, inspection, and testing.
Sustainable Glass Packaging: Environmental impact of glass packaging, recycling and reuse, and sustainable design principles.
Glass Packaging Applications: Case studies of glass packaging applications, including food, beverage, pharmaceutical, and cosmetic products.
Regulatory Compliance in Glass Packaging: Regulations and standards for glass packaging, including FDA, EU, and other international requirements.
